But safety is only part of the story. Every tap, grip, and toss with this little ball sets off a cascade of neurological activity in your baby’s growing brain. From the very first grasp, infants begin mapping their world through touch, movement, and sound. The slightly ribbed texture of the ball’s exterior provides gentle resistance against delicate fingertips, stimulating nerve endings and enhancing fine motor control. When they slap it against the floor and watch it spring back, hand-eye coordination gets a playful workout. And when they roll it toward you—or chase it across the rug—they’re building spatial awareness and cause-effect understanding, all wrapped in laughter. Color plays its own role in this learning journey. The bold red interior and vibrant green outer rind create a high-contrast visual stimulus ideal for young eyes still refining focus and tracking ability. Developmental experts agree that contrasting colors help strengthen visual processing pathways during the critical early months, making this cheerful watermelon more than just cute—it’s cognitively smart.
